A shootout near a popular hot dog stand left one man dead and another critically wounded Tuesday night in the University Village neighborhood.

Around 10:30 p.m., occupants of a red car and dark-colored SUV were outside Jim’s Originals, 1250 S. Union Ave., when they left their vehicles and began shooting at each other in the street, Chicago police said.

A man was shot in the face and he was taken to Stroger Hospital where he was pronounced dead, police said.

A 19-year-old man shot in the face was dropped off at Rush Hospital, but he was transferred to Stroger in critical condition, officials said.

No one was in custody in the attack and Area Three detectives are investigating.
